Minya vs Faiz Abad Climate & Distance Between

Afghanistan flag
  • The distance between Minya, Egypt and Faiz Abad, Afghanistan is approximately 3,830 km or 2,380 mi.
  • To reach Minya in this distance one would set out from Faiz Abad bearing 266.6° or W and follow the great circles arc to approach Minya bearing 244.5° or WSW .
  • Minya has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Faiz Abad has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a).
  • Minya is in or near the subtropical desert biome whereas Faiz Abad is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
  • The mean annual temperature is 7.4 °C (13.2°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 8.4 °C (15.1°F) less in Minya.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 479.9 mm (18.9 in) less which is equivalent to 479.9 l/m² (11.78 US gal/ft²) or 4,799,000 l/ha (513,045 US gal/ac) less. About 0 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 9° higher in Minya than in Faiz Abad.
  • Relative humidity levels are 3.8% lower.
  • The mean dew point temperature is 6.5°C (11.8°F) higher.
